mjr46, question - Is there much point in upgrading the upper and lower intakes on a stock 302 setup? If i were to buy the above for an example and place them on my 87 E7 stock long block, would i have to take in consideration any other factors such as upgrading the fuel injectors, calibrated MAF ect due to the extra increase in the volume air entering the engine? Or do the heads mainly play that role?, thus needing the better lower and upper intakes?

there are gains, but they are minimal. the stock heads are the biggest restriction in air flow. upgrading the intake wont require bigger injectors.

I've put cobra intakes /UPPER, LOWERS on stock 5.0's as a single mod, and the gains were minimal .1 to .2 tenths gain at the track was the last one I did for a guy and that was his gain, I'm not a fan of piece work modding when it comes to heads, cams and intakes, I like to do it as a package deal so the biggest bang can be felt all at once
